Dynamic

Disequilibrium vs Market Equilibrium

Developers should understand disequilibrium to identify and address inefficiencies in software systems, team workflows, or project scopes, such as when technical debt accumulates, resource allocation becomes skewed, or user feedback contradicts initial assumptions meets developers should understand market equilibrium when building applications in economics, finance, e-commerce, or resource allocation systems, as it helps model pricing, inventory management, and market dynamics. Here's our take.

🧊Nice Pick

Disequilibrium

Developers should understand disequilibrium to identify and address inefficiencies in software systems, team workflows, or project scopes, such as when technical debt accumulates, resource allocation becomes skewed, or user feedback contradicts initial assumptions

Disequilibrium

Nice Pick

Developers should understand disequilibrium to identify and address inefficiencies in software systems, team workflows, or project scopes, such as when technical debt accumulates, resource allocation becomes skewed, or user feedback contradicts initial assumptions

Pros

  • +Learning this concept helps in applying agile methodologies, continuous improvement practices, and systems thinking to proactively manage changes and maintain project health, ensuring sustainable development and better outcomes
  • +Related to: systems-thinking, agile-methodologies

Cons

  • -Specific tradeoffs depend on your use case

Market Equilibrium

Developers should understand market equilibrium when building applications in economics, finance, e-commerce, or resource allocation systems, as it helps model pricing, inventory management, and market dynamics

Pros

  • +For example, in algorithmic trading platforms, it can inform price prediction models, while in ride-sharing apps, it aids in surge pricing algorithms to balance supply and demand
  • +Related to: supply-and-demand, microeconomics

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use Disequilibrium if: You want learning this concept helps in applying agile methodologies, continuous improvement practices, and systems thinking to proactively manage changes and maintain project health, ensuring sustainable development and better outcomes and can live with specific tradeoffs depend on your use case.

Use Market Equilibrium if: You prioritize for example, in algorithmic trading platforms, it can inform price prediction models, while in ride-sharing apps, it aids in surge pricing algorithms to balance supply and demand over what Disequilibrium offers.

🧊
The Bottom Line
Disequilibrium wins

Developers should understand disequilibrium to identify and address inefficiencies in software systems, team workflows, or project scopes, such as when technical debt accumulates, resource allocation becomes skewed, or user feedback contradicts initial assumptions

Disagree with our pick? nice@nicepick.dev